Understanding the process

The first thing you need to know is that each package is unique. It's assigned a unique number, known as an airway bill number. This number is your key to knowing where your package is at any given time. It's like a map, guiding you through the journey of your package. You receive this number when you ship your package.

You don't need any special tools or software to monitor your package. All you need is access to the internet and the airway bill number. It's easy and convenient, allowing you to keep tabs on your package from the comfort of your home or office.

Executing the monitoring

Now that you have your airway bill number and internet access, you can start monitoring your package. Visit the official website of the Argentine air freight company. Look for a section called "Shipment Status" or something similar. Enter your airway bill number in the designated field and click on "Search" or "Track". You should now be able to see the current location of your package, its estimated delivery date, and its journey history.

Remember, the information is updated in real-time, so you can check back anytime for the most up-to-date status of your package. It's a simple yet effective way to keep track of your package, giving you peace of mind and making your shipping experience as smooth as possible.

Step-by-Step Guide to Aerolineas Cargo Package Tracking

Imagine you've sent a package via a renowned air freight service, and you're keen to keep tabs on its journey. This section is here to guide you through the process, step-by-step, minus the jargon and complexities. We'll make it easy for you.

Let's break down the process into simple, manageable steps.

  1. First and foremost, you need to have your unique shipment number handy. It's the identifier given to you by the air freight company when you send a package.
  2. Next, head over to the air freight company's official website. Look for a section on the homepage that allows you to monitor your shipment's progress. This is usually labelled "Track Your Shipment" or something similar.
  3. Enter your unique shipment number into the provided field. Make sure to double-check the number for any errors before proceeding.
  4. Hit the "Submit" or "Track" button. Wait for the system to retrieve your shipment's details.
  5. Voila! The status of your package should appear on your screen. This will include details such as the current location of the package, the estimated time of arrival (ETA), and any other relevant updates.

Remember, the accuracy of the information depends on the air freight company updating their system in a timely manner. Sometimes, due to unforeseen circumstances, there might be slight delays in updates. Therefore, it's always a good idea to check back periodically if you're expecting a critical shipment. Also, keep in mind that the tracking system operates 24/7, so you can check your shipment's status anytime, anywhere!
